# Pure PHP

- [Webauthn Server](/v4.0-erin-elderflower/pure-php/the-hard-way.md)
- [Register Authenticators](/v4.0-erin-elderflower/pure-php/authenticator-registration.md)
- [Authenticate Your Users](/v4.0-erin-elderflower/pure-php/authenticate-your-users.md)
- [Advanced Behaviours](/v4.0-erin-elderflower/pure-php/advanced-behaviours.md)
- [Debugging](/v4.0-erin-elderflower/pure-php/advanced-behaviours/debugging.md)
- [User Verification](/v4.0-erin-elderflower/pure-php/advanced-behaviours/user-verification.md)
- [Authenticator Selection Criteria](/v4.0-erin-elderflower/pure-php/advanced-behaviours/authenticator-selection-criteria.md)
- [Attestation and Metadata Statement](/v4.0-erin-elderflower/pure-php/advanced-behaviours/attestation-and-metadata-statement.md)
- [Authentication without username](/v4.0-erin-elderflower/pure-php/advanced-behaviours/authentication-without-username.md)
- [Extensions](/v4.0-erin-elderflower/pure-php/advanced-behaviours/extensions.md)
- [Authenticator Counter](/v4.0-erin-elderflower/pure-php/advanced-behaviours/authenticator-counter.md)
- [Dealing with “localhost”](/v4.0-erin-elderflower/pure-php/advanced-behaviours/dealing-with-localhost.md)
